About the Family & Belonging Foundation & Eligibility
Family & Belonging, defined as “caring for those around you,” was one of Melting Pot’s guiding principles. In 2007, the Family & Belonging Foundation was established to help Melting Pot team members in times of hardship and adversity. It also provides financial assistance to select team members, furthering their education through a General Studies Scholarship.
The Melting Pot Family & Belonging Foundation is administered by the Family & Belonging Committee. The Committee is comprised of the Strategic Partnership Committee with administrative support from the Foundation Treasurer, Scott Pierce, CFO of The Melting Pot Restaurants, Inc.

Who is eligible?
To be eligible for a General Studies Scholarship:
- Be presently employed at a Melting Pot restaurant
- Be enrolled or plan to enroll in higher education by December 31, 2026
- Apply online by May 25, 2026
If selected as a scholarship recipient, you must be an active employee of a Melting Pot location at the time you submit your proof of enrollment in higher education.
